Gilbert, Michael B. – School Organisation, 1989
Although listening is the most widely used communication skill, it is rarely taught. This study of California and Arkansas principals explored how principals and their staffs perceived the principals' listening behaviors. Results suggest that principals and their staffs perceived the principals to be moderately good listeners. Includes 11…

Okeafor, Karen R.; Poole, Marybeth G. – Journal of Curriculum and Supervision, 1992
Summarizes a study exploring how teachers characterize their administrators' supervisory behaviors and administrator-teacher relationships, including how administrators show respect for teachers. Four distinct supervisor patterns (backstage, collaborative, surly, and imperial) emerged. Data indicate a correlation between principals' respect for…

Hoffman, James; And Others – Journal of School Leadership, 1994
Identifies important aspects of faculty trust and school climate. Trust in the principal and trust in colleagues were aspects of faculty trust that were affected in this study of middle schools. The organizational climate factors of supportive, directive, and restrictive principal behavior and collegial, committed, and disengaged teacher behavior…
